On the occasion of the celebrations of the centenary of Virginia Woolf's
Mrs Dalloway, Prof. Dr.
Laura Scuriatti gave a talk entitled "Una forza generatrice: riscrivere
Mrs Dalloway nel XXI secolo" (A generative force: rewriting
Mrs Dalloway in the 21st century) at Milan State University on December 5, 2025. The talk offered an overview of some of the most recent rewritings of
Mrs Dalloway in English and German, showing how the content and style of the novel have been rewritten in order to revitalize its political content and make it relevant for understanding contemporary issues.
Prof. Scuriatti also participated in a round table discussion on the volume
The Edinburgh Companion to Virginia Woolf and Transnational Perspectives, published by Edinburgh University Press (2025), of which she is a contributor.
